Hi folks, I would like to share with you my project.
It is an Arduino based alarm system which consists of 4x4 matrix keypad, 16x02 LCD screen connected to board using 2-wire schematic on 74LS164 and ATmega328p.

Here is the sources: https://github.com/mykh/Burglar-and-Fire-Alarm-System-Arduino

First of all I want to thank you guys for your comments. I really appreciate it.
I spent on this project about 25 USD:
* electrical panel box - $3
* 4x4 Matrix keypad - $4
* 1602 LCD - $4
* ATmega328p - $4
* prototype board, buzzer, relay, 74LS164, etc. - ~$10
